Air Walk spell question

I was wondering, can a person sit in the Lotus position or lie down in mid-air using the Air Walk spell?

Or do you HAVE to be standing and walking?


Sit probably as long as you aren't moving ... I'd probably allow this.
Ditto for lying down.

I'd pretty much let you treat the air as if it were solid ground.

But it is not flying, and I probably not let you move any more effectively through the air in the lotus position than I would if you were sitting on the actual ground and trying to scoot along on your behind.

RAW I've no idea big grey/GM's decision area.


"The subject can tread on air as if walking on solid ground."

So movement happens only if they use their feet, but you can probably sit/lie down, you would just be stationary.


I'd allow it.
